Output 1052daa8f0e80231dd5c31adca632262937e00dc5b23169664f465bae6b2b1c8:0

value
25489580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7e3eafe65658bece647ae3c097e25d8a69367e3 OP_EQUAL
address
3KuwRjYmqfxXr56tfPH2ZZQTNRMyqBeY2A
transaction
1052daa8f0e80231dd5c31adca632262937e00dc5b23169664f465bae6b2b1c8
spent
true